CuriosityStream (CURI) market outlook | technical trading signals, analyst upgrades, institutional support. CuriosityStream Inc. (CURI) closed at $2.74, shedding 0.72% in recent trading. The stock remains within a narrow range between support at $2.60 and resistance at $2.88, reflecting a period of consolidation after earlier volatility. Traders are watching whether the current level holds as a floor or gives way to further downside.

Trading volume during the session appeared consistent with recent averages, suggesting no panic selling or unusual accumulation behind the small decline. The streaming and media sector has faced headwinds from shifting consumer preferences and rising content costs, and CuriosityStream, as a niche player focused on factual documentaries, continues to navigate a competitive landscape dominated by larger platforms. Key drivers behind the move may include broader market sentiment toward small-cap growth stocks, as well as company-specific factors such as subscriber growth updates or content licensing deals. The stock’s recent price action has been characterized by low volatility, with daily moves often less than 2%, indicating that investors are awaiting clearer catalysts. CuriosityStream’s positioning in the educational and documentary niche could provide a differentiation factor, but the company must demonstrate sustained revenue growth and a path to profitability to attract long-term buying interest. The current price level of $2.74 sits near the lower end of its one-year range, and any further deterioration in fundamentals or market sentiment could pressure shares toward the support zone. From a technical perspective, CuriosityStream is currently testing a key support level near $2.60, a price point that has historically attracted buyers and provided a floor in recent months. Resistance remains established at $2.88, which has capped upside moves on multiple occasions. The stock’s price action has formed a tight consolidation pattern, suggesting that a breakout in either direction could be significant. Momentum indicators are currently neutral; the relative strength index (RSI) likely sits in the low-to-mid 40s, indicating neither overbought nor oversold conditions. The 50-day moving average may be acting as overhead resistance in the $2.80–$2.85 neighborhood, while the 200-day moving average could be trending lower, confirming a longer-term downtrend. Despite the recent small decline, the stock has not made a new low, and the chart shows a potential double-bottom formation around $2.60 if that level holds. Volume has been declining during this consolidation phase, which sometimes precedes a directional move. A break above $2.88 would signal a bullish reversal, while a drop below $2.60 could open the door to further losses toward $2.40 or lower. Looking ahead, several factors may influence CuriosityStream’s near-term trajectory. If the stock holds above $2.60, a bounce toward resistance at $2.88 could materialize, especially if the broader market stabilizes or the company announces positive developments such as a new content partnership or subscriber milestone. Conversely, a decisive breakdown below $2.60 might trigger stop-loss orders and accelerate selling, potentially driving the stock toward $2.40 or even the $2.20 area, levels seen earlier this year. The upcoming earnings report will be a crucial catalyst, as investors will scrutinize revenue trends, subscriber numbers, and management’s guidance on cash burn and profitability. Additionally, any shift in analyst ratings or institutional interest could sway sentiment. Because the stock is trading near support, the risk/reward profile may be more favorable for those looking for a bounce, but caution is warranted given the stock’s low liquidity and volatile history. Factors such as changes in streaming industry dynamics, content licensing costs, and the company’s ability to differentiate itself will remain key. The next few weeks will likely determine whether the $2.60 level holds as a launchpad or becomes a pivot point for further declines.
